Winter Solstice Fire

Yesterday, I bought some beeswax candles so I can be ready for the Solstice.

Every Winter Solstice, around noon, I like to use a magnifying lens to ignite a match and then set the flame on a candle. From that candle, we light the candles in our fireplace and then watch them as the day grows darker.

This year the solstice is 9:30 PM on Dec 21, so I'm calling the noon of the 21st the Solstice Noon. If it is not too cloudy, stop by with a candle after noon and I will light it with solstice fire. Um, no, I'm not going to sing any Doors songs or do a re-enactment of Rent.
